Let's take a quick look at the total impossibility that you could set
up a fake plane crash site and get away with it. First you need all
the material for the fake crash on standby and ready to deploy faster
than the search and rescues crews. Material would include a look alike
airplane and look alike freshly dead bodies to match the general
appearance of all the passengers. You also need to dress up your
corpses with identification papers, personal effects, heirloom
jewelry, and recent dental work. (Not to mention matching DNA, I don't
want to get too scientific here.) That's quite a shopping list. Even
if you did have all that ready to go (which is 99.9% impossible and/or
unbelievable) next there would be thousands of investigators crawling
all over the fake wreck with fine tooth combs. So you can't deploy the
fake wreck in time and the fake wreck could never be good enough to
pass a typical plane wreck scrutiny.
